Our Second topic — The Early Release of Former Rogue Cop Jason Van Dyke.
Jason Van Dyke early released from prison only served half of his sentence for killing Laquan McDonald. Six years after Laquan McDonald was shot 16 times by former Rogue Cop Jason Van Dyke. McDonald’s family and local activist are still seeking accountability for McDonald’s murder the family is seeking federal charges. Jason Van Dyke was released from state prison three years earlier due to good behavior. He was convicted in 2018 of second degree murder and 16 counts of aggravated battery one for each bullet he fired at McDonald. Judge Vincent Gonz sentenced the former police officer to 81 months in prison.

Another high profile case of a Rogue Cop killing a young unarmed black man Ex-Cop Kim Potter sentenced to only 2 Years for killing Daunte Wright.
On April 11, 2021, Daunte Wright, a 20-year-old Black man, was fatally shot by Rogue Cop Kimberly Potter during a traffic stop and attempted arrest for an outstanding warrant in Brooklyn Center, Minnesota. After a brief struggle with officers, Potter shot Wright in the chest once at close range. He then drove off a short distance, but his vehicle collided with another and hit a concrete barrier. Potter said she meant to use her Taser just before shooting her gun. The shooting sparked protests in Brooklyn Center and renewed ongoing demonstrations against police shootings in the Minneapolis–Saint Paul metropolitan area, leading to citywide and regional curfews. Demonstrations took place over several days, and spread to cities across the United States. Two days after the incident, Potter and Brooklyn Center police chief Tim Gannon resigned from their positions.

Potter was convicted of first-degree manslaughter and second-degree manslaughter on December 23, 2021, at a jury trial. On February 18, 2022, she was sentenced to two years in prison, with credit for time served. The events led to several police reforms in Brooklyn Center, Minneapolis.
